Mount Suribachi, Iwo Jima Island
100,000 US Marines were sent to capture the Island, February 19th,1945
First Mission, Arrive to the Top of Mount
Suribachi
US Marines fought during 4 Days climbing
over the Mount Suribachi . There were only 10,000 Japanese, but the Japanese resist
fiercy to hold the Mount.
On February 23rd,1945,US
Marines conquered the Mt Suribachi after 4 days
climbing against
Japanese.
6 US Marines raised the American Flag at the Top of Mt Suribachi in Iwo Jima Island on February 23rd of 1945.
Joe Rosenthal
Photographer ,took the picture with his camera. .
The Film was sent by Airplane to the Island of Guam , then it was transmited by radio to
New York .

From Guam Island was radiotransmited to Associated Press Headquarters in NY.USA.
Associated Press Headquarters in New York
Newspapers all over
USA decided to
print huge
copies of Joe
Rosenthal Picture
next day.
Felix DeWeldon made a Miniature Statue of the Iwo
Jima picture .
Franklin Roosevelt ordered to please back to the USA the Six men who have raised the flag.
It was too late . Mike Strank, Harlon Block and Franklin Sousley were dead
Returned to USA only .
Back in United States, the 3 survivors traveled all over the country with the small statue to collect money for the War.
Postage Stamp of Iwo Jima photo.
137 Millions were printed.
People demanded a huge copy.
In 1954 , Dwight Eisenhower led
ceremonies ,the 3 survivors were present.
